Abstract

The implementation of clean and healthy living behavior in schools is still low because there is still a lack of socialization regarding the benefits and risks of not implementing clean and healthy living behavior in everyday life. Due to the low socialization of clean and healthy living behavior, the willingness of students to implement it is also low, which results in disrupted school community health. PHBS is an effort to provide learning experiences for individuals, families, groups, and communities by opening communication channels, providing information, and providing education to improve knowledge, attitudes, and behavior, through a leadership approach (advocacy), fostering an atmosphere (social support), and community empowerment (empowerment) so that they can implement healthy living methods, to maintain, preserve and improve public health (Ministry of Health of the Republic of Indonesia, 2011). Community service in the form of counseling aims to increase students' knowledge of how to increase individual awareness in carrying out clean and healthy daily living behavior in children, especially students of SMP Negeri No. 2 Tapaktuan, South Aceh Regency. The activity method starts with a survey of the counseling location at SMPN 2 Tapaktuan, making counseling materials and implementing counseling. The implementation is before providing education about PHBS, the team of community service lecturers first conducted socialization then gave a pre-test by the community service team and the following stage provided education about PHBS in schools. The results of the pre-test scores from student knowledge with a good category of 20 (50%) and from the implementation of PHBS 25 (62.5%) answered (Yes), and after education, the post-test score for knowledge was 33 (82.5%), the implementation of PHBS 35 (87.5%). This figure is large enough to say that this activity was successful, but there are still students who have not met good scores. Abstract

Hypertension is an abnormal increase in systolic pressure of 140 mmHg or more and diastolic pressure of 120 mmHg. In Indonesia, hypertension ranks 2nd out of the 10 most common diseases in hospital outpatients. Hypertension cannot be cured but can be controlled. Regular blood pressure checks are key in the management of the disease. Seeing this data, it is important to provide the right information through simple technical assistance to families, cadres, and the elderly to prevent and manage hypertension. The community service activity carried out is skill assistance to families and cadres in managing hypertension in the elderly in Ladang Baro Village, Meukek District, South Aceh Regency. The problems faced by partners include the lack of knowledge and skills of families and cadres in managing hypertension in the elderly. The purpose of this community service activity is to increase the knowledge and skills of the elderly, families, and cadres in managing hypertension. The problem solution offered in this community service is to provide education about hypertension and provide training to health cadres and selected communities on how to use digital tensimeters for blood pressure checks so that they can carry out appropriate management related to the disease they experience.
